Hence, kindly follow these troubleshooting steps to isolate your concern properly: Method 1: Run the Hardware and devices troubleshooter. Click the Start menu, and click SETTINGS. Type Troubleshooting on the search box. In the new window, click Hardware and Sound. Click Hardware and Devices and run the troubleshooter.

As far as I know, you just run the PCSX2 until you got to the main menu, then in the menu bar choose Config > Gamepad Settings, it should automatically pick your keyboard up as Gamepad.0 (Player One). IMHO the default layout is pretty logical, though you can of course rebind everything by clicking on the button name
